Montgomery home prices rise in the third quarter of 2018

The median sale price of a home sold in the third quarter of 2018 in Montgomery rose by $42,100 while total sales decreased by 4.9%, according to BlockShopper.com.

From July through September of 2018, there were 39 homes sold, with a median sale price of $432,000 - a 10.8% increase over the $389,900 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 41 homes sold in Montgomery in the third quarter of 2017.
